Nerima Midori Festa" held for the first time !.This text has been translated by auto-translation. There may be a slight difference between the original text and the translation. (Original Language: 日本語)
Nerima Ward will hold the Nerima Midori Festa for the first time at the Tokyo Metropolitan Hikarigaoka Park on ( Sunday, 22nd ).
There are 43 forests in the city ・ that are open to residents of the ward. These are precious places where you can feel the blessings of nature close at hand.
At the Festa, various programs for playing, experiencing, and learning about greenery will be held by 18 groups that are active in recreational forests and other areas in the ward, as well as in activities to protect and nurture greenery. This is an event where children and adults can come into direct contact with greenery and living creatures, and through play and experience, enjoy and feel the charms of Nerima.

Katsushika City and the Katsushika Branch of the Tokyo Chamber of Commerce and Industry held the 12th Machi-Factory Trade Fair 2026 on February 19 ( Thursday ) ・ 20th ( Friday ) at Tokyo International Forum ( Chiyoda-ku ).
Companies from inside and outside of Katsushika City exhibited their various technologies and products such as precision processing, resin molding, prototype development, etc. Business talks and technical consultations with the visitors were held everywhere in the venue, and active exchanges were observed.
■ Initiatives of Exhibiting Companies
One of the exhibiting companies, Katsushika Corporation ( Nishi-shinkoiwa, Katsushika-ku, Tokyo ), is a manufacturer of lip containers and packages for cosmetic manufacturers. The company was newly certified this year as a "Katsushika Machi Factory Story," a Katsushika brand recognized by the ward for its high technological capabilities and narrative product ・technology.
Mr. Kamon, the company's section chief, said, "Depending on the company placing the order, there are cases where a new mold is made or an existing mold is used. There is a big difference in cost between making a mold from scratch and using an off-the-shelf mold," he explains.
Even when ready-made molds are used, differentiation is achieved through ingenuity in cap design and detailed processing. "Even with ready-made molds, brands can express their individuality through ingenuity in design and processing," he said.
Exhibition booth of Katsushika Corporation
■ In cooperation with "Atotsugi Koshien" organized by the Small and Medium Enterprise Agency, successors of manufacturing companies are invited from all over Japan
Successors or prospective successors of small and medium enterprises compete for new businesses utilizing their existing management resources. Atotsugi Koshien" ( where they compete for ideas ) hosted by the Small and Medium Enterprise Agencyand introduced various "Atotsugi" products and business cases from all over Japan through presentation competitions and booth exhibits in the town factory sample city. From Katsushika City, Isomura Sangyo Corporation ( Nishi-Shinkoiwa, Katsushika City ), a metal processing business, took the stage to present their business and business development for the future.
■ A place for technology transmission and sales channel development
Katsushika Ward is home to a diverse range of manufacturing industries, including metal and resin processing, and manufacturing companies rooted in the community are continuing their activities. The Machi-Factory Trade Fair is held to support the development of sales channels for small and medium-sized enterprises in and outside of the ward, to disseminate technology, and to provide opportunities for business matching.
This trade fair also provided an opportunity for companies to interact with each other, leading to technical consultation and business transactions.

Spring Blood Donation CampaignThis text has been translated by auto-translation. There may be a slight difference between the original text and the translation. (Original Language: 日本語)
The Tokyo Metropolitan Government will hold a spring blood donation campaign from March 1 to March 31.
Blood cannot be artificially produced nor can it be stored for long periods of time. In order to provide a stable supply of blood products to those in need of transfusions due to illness or injury, we need your continued cooperation in blood donation.
In the Spring Blood Donation Campaign, we will work with companies to call for cooperation in blood donation, and will use posters ・videos and other means to publicize the campaign. We ask for your understanding ・ and cooperation.

In Ome City, the first case of plum pomelo virus (PPV) was confirmed in Japan in 2009, and about 40,000 ume trees were cut down in the entire city area. After that, replanting of ume trees was approved and started in 2016, and this year (2026) will mark the 10th anniversary.
As a special 10th anniversary year, a commemorative tree planting ceremony will be held on the first day of the festival, and various other events will be held during the period.
